探索iOS动画新境界:Pop Animation Playground
项目介绍
在iOS开发的世界里,动画是提升用户体验的关键因素之一。为了帮助开发者更好地掌握和应用动画技术,我们推出了Pop Animation Playground for iOS项目。这个项目基于Facebook的Pop动画库,提供了一系列示例动画,旨在帮助开发者快速上手并深入理解Pop动画库的使用。
项目技术分析
Pop Animation Playground for iOS项目主要依赖于以下技术:
-
Facebook Pop动画库:Pop是Facebook开发的一个强大的动画引擎,支持iOS和OS X平台。它提供了丰富的动画效果,包括弹性动画、衰减动画等,能够帮助开发者轻松实现复杂的动画效果。
-
CocoaPods:作为iOS开发中最流行的依赖管理工具,CocoaPods使得项目的依赖管理变得简单高效。通过CocoaPods,开发者可以轻松集成Pop动画库到自己的项目中。
项目及技术应用场景
Pop Animation Playground for iOS项目适用于以下场景:
-
学习与研究:对于初学者来说,项目中的示例动画是学习Pop动画库的绝佳资源。通过实际操作,开发者可以快速掌握Pop动画库的基本用法和高级技巧。
-
项目开发:对于正在开发iOS应用的开发者,Pop Animation Playground提供了丰富的动画示例,可以直接借鉴或修改后应用到自己的项目中,提升应用的用户体验。
-
开源贡献:项目鼓励开发者通过Fork和提交Pull Request的方式,共同完善和扩展示例动画库,使其成为一个更加丰富和全面的资源。
项目特点
-
丰富的示例动画:项目中包含了多种类型的动画示例,涵盖了从基础到高级的各种动画效果,帮助开发者全面了解Pop动画库的功能。
-
易于上手:通过简单的几步操作,开发者就可以将项目运行起来,并开始探索和学习Pop动画库的使用。
-
开源社区支持:项目鼓励开发者参与贡献,通过社区的力量不断完善和扩展示例动画库,使其成为一个更加强大和全面的资源。
-
官方支持:项目基于Facebook官方的Pop动画库,确保了技术的可靠性和稳定性,开发者可以放心使用。
如何开始
- 克隆项目:首先,通过Git克隆项目到本地。
- 安装CocoaPods:确保你已经安装了CocoaPods,如果没有,可以通过CocoaPods官网进行安装。
- 安装依赖:在项目目录下运行
pod install
命令,安装项目依赖。 - 打开项目:使用Xcode打开
PopPlayground.xcworkspace
文件。 - 运行项目:编译并运行项目,开始探索和学习Pop动画库。
其他资源
- Facebook官方Pop仓库:了解更多关于Pop动画库的信息,可以访问Facebook官方Pop仓库。
- 官方公告:查看Facebook关于Pop动画库的官方公告。
- Tapity博客:Jeremy Olson在Tapity的博客上有一篇详细的入门教程,包含视频演示,非常适合初学者。
通过Pop Animation Playground for iOS项目,你将能够轻松掌握Pop动画库的使用,为你的iOS应用增添更多动感和活力。快来加入我们,一起探索iOS动画的新境界吧!